There are 2 types of subs here: Italian, and "Other Subs", so you know that this shop sprang from the vibrant Italian community that once populated Detroit. The Italian Subs at Gonella's are ordered according to how many layers it builds up (which I think is a unique concept). These layered Gonella Italian Subs are layered with a variety of Italian meats (Hard Salami, Salami Cotto, Mortadella, Smoked Ham and Capicola), provolone cheese, lettuce, tomatoes, onions & Gonella's homemade dressing. Soft or hard roll. Extras: Peppers (+.50) Cheese (+.50) - (Turkey is reserved for the "Other Subs). 6 Layers Meat, 1 Layer Cheese --- $8 8 Layers Meat, 2 Layer Cheese --- $9 12 Layers Meat, 2 Layer Cheese --- $12 14 Layers Meat, 3 Layer Cheese --- $13 18 Layers Meat, 3 Layer Cheese --- $14 The subs are heavy and delicious. The Service is ultra friendly. And the atmosphere feels like and Italian Deli-Market. I recommend it.
